NMAR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review
28 of the 7,596 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Innovator Growth-100 Power Buffer ETF - March (NMAR)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$44.6M — up 46% from $30.5M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 9 funds opened new NMAR positions and 4 closed out — a net gain of 5 holders — while 12 added to existing stakes and 4 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Cresset Asset Management, adding an estimated $2.27M. The largest seller was Susquehanna International Group, cutting an estimated $1.24M.
